Ling's parents has been separated when she was small, however, she always miss her brother, Ding. Ling's boyfriend is a social worker. One day, he sees a youngster who looks like Ling's brother and loves drinking cream soda and milk. Nevertheless, Ding doesn't want to meet his sister..

Chronicles the growth of a young woman as she dabbles in Hong Kong’s independent film scene. Based in part on Hui’s real-life experiences.

The movie was originally a TV series exported by "9 Hong Kong Radio & TV Department". Its film version was used as a commemorative work for the 60th Anniversary of Radio 9 Hong Kong for a charity screening at the cinema. It describes the lives of firefighter Jiang Jiahe and his life before his death from cancer. Jiang's family is a dedicated firefighter. He loves his wife and family. Unfortunately, he contracted nasopharyngeal cancer. He was initially calm and under the careful treatment and care of the doctor and his wife, but his family was hit by a series of blows: his father was injured and fell to death; his younger brother’s career was frustrated; to solve family life, He was a part-time taxi driver who suffered from lung cancer because of overwork...
